fix: redact sensitive data from diagnostics files before sharing

Addresses the security concern raised in #12284 where diagnostic files
contain sensitive information (API keys, tokens, secrets) that users
might accidentally share.

Changes:
- Add redact utility (src/utils/redact.ts) with pattern-based redaction
  for common API keys (Anthropic, OpenAI, OpenRouter, Google, AWS, GitHub),
  Bearer tokens, environment variable secrets, and JSON key-value secrets
- Apply redactDiagnosticsData() in diagnosticsHandler.ts before writing
  the diagnostics file to disk
- Update the header comment to inform users that sensitive data has been
  automatically redacted, while still advising manual review
- Add comprehensive tests for both the redaction utility and its
  integration in the diagnostics handler

/**
* Redacts sensitive information from diagnostic output to prevent accidental
* disclosure of API keys, tokens, passwords, and other secrets.
*
* This module is used by the diagnostics handler to sanitize conversation
* history before it is written to a file that users may share with support.
*/
/**
* Patterns that match common API key and secret formats.
* Each entry has a regex and a label used in the redacted replacement.
*/
const SENSITIVE_PATTERNS: { pattern: RegExp; label: string }[] = [
// Anthropic API keys: sk-ant-api03-...
{ pattern: /\bsk-ant-[\w-]{20,}\b/g, label: "ANTHROPIC_API_KEY" },
// OpenRouter API keys: sk-or-v1-... (must come before generic OpenAI pattern)
{ pattern: /\bsk-or-v1-[\w]{20,}\b/g, label: "OPENROUTER_API_KEY" },
// OpenAI API keys: sk-... (but not sk-ant or sk-or which are other providers)
{ pattern: /\bsk-(?!ant|or-)[\w-]{20,}\b/g, label: "OPENAI_API_KEY" },
// Generic secret key patterns: key-..., api-key-...
{ pattern: /\bkey-[\w-]{20,}\b/g, label: "API_KEY" },
// AWS access keys
{ pattern: /\b(?:AKIA|ASIA)[A-Z0-9]{16}\b/g, label: "AWS_ACCESS_KEY" },
// AWS secret keys (40 char base64-like)
{ pattern: /\b[A-Za-z0-9/+=]{40}\b(?=.*(?:aws|secret|access))/gi, label: "AWS_SECRET_KEY" },
// Google API keys
{ pattern: /\bAIza[A-Za-z0-9_-]{35}\b/g, label: "GOOGLE_API_KEY" },
// GitHub tokens: ghp_, gho_, ghu_, ghs_, ghr_
{ pattern: /\bgh[pousr]_[A-Za-z0-9_]{36,}\b/g, label: "GITHUB_TOKEN" },
// Generic Bearer tokens in authorization headers
{ pattern: /Bearer\s+[A-Za-z0-9._~+/=-]{20,}/gi, label: "BEARER_TOKEN" },
// Generic base64-encoded long tokens (likely secrets) after common key names
{
pattern:
/(?<="(?:api[_-]?key|apikey|api[_-]?secret|secret[_-]?key|access[_-]?token|auth[_-]?token|token|password|passwd|secret|credential|private[_-]?key|authorization)":\s*")[^"]{20,}/gi,
label: "REDACTED_SECRET",
},
// Azure keys (32 hex chars)
{ pattern: /\b[a-f0-9]{32}\b(?=.*(?:azure|endpoint|cognitive))/gi, label: "AZURE_KEY" },
// Generic hex tokens that appear after key-like field names (in JSON context)
{
pattern: /(?<="(?:api[_-]?key|apikey|secret|token|password|credential)":\s*")[a-f0-9-]{32,}(?=")/gi,
label: "REDACTED_SECRET",
},
]
/**
* Patterns for environment variable assignments containing secrets.
* Matches patterns like: SOME_API_KEY=value or export SOME_SECRET="value"
*/
const ENV_VAR_PATTERNS: RegExp[] = [
// KEY=value patterns (unquoted)
/\b([A-Z_]*(?:KEY|SECRET|TOKEN|PASSWORD|CREDENTIAL|AUTH)[A-Z_]*)=([^\s"']{8,})\b/gi,
// KEY="value" or KEY='value' patterns (quoted)
/\b([A-Z_]*(?:KEY|SECRET|TOKEN|PASSWORD|CREDENTIAL|AUTH)[A-Z_]*)=["']([^"']{8,})["']/gi,
// export KEY=value
/\bexport\s+([A-Z_]*(?:KEY|SECRET|TOKEN|PASSWORD|CREDENTIAL|AUTH)[A-Z_]*)=["']?([^\s"']{8,})["']?/gi,
]
/**
* Redacts sensitive information from a string.
*
* Applies pattern-based redaction to remove API keys, tokens, passwords,
* and other secrets that may appear in conversation history or error details.
*
* @param input - The string to redact sensitive information from
* @returns The input string with sensitive values replaced by redaction markers
*/
export function redactSensitiveInfo(input: string): string {
if (!input || typeof input !== "string") {
return input
}
let result = input
// Apply sensitive patterns
for (const { pattern, label } of SENSITIVE_PATTERNS) {
// Reset lastIndex for global regexes
pattern.lastIndex = 0
result = result.replace(pattern, `[${label}]`)
}
// Redact environment variable assignments with secret-like names
for (const pattern of ENV_VAR_PATTERNS) {
pattern.lastIndex = 0
result = result.replace(pattern, (_match, name) => `${name}=[REDACTED]`)
}
return result
}
/**
* Recursively redacts sensitive information from an object structure.
*
* Walks through objects and arrays, applying string redaction to all
* string values. This is used to redact the full diagnostics payload
* (including nested conversation history) before writing to a file.
*
* @param data - The data structure to redact (object, array, or primitive)
* @returns A new data structure with sensitive string values redacted
*/
export function redactDiagnosticsData(data: unknown): unknown {
if (data === null || data === undefined) {
return data
}
if (typeof data === "string") {
return redactSensitiveInfo(data)
}
if (Array.isArray(data)) {
return data.map((item) => redactDiagnosticsData(item))
}
if (typeof data === "object") {
const result: Record<string, unknown> = {}
for (const [key, value] of Object.entries(data)) {
// For keys that are known to hold secrets, redact the entire value
const lowerKey = key.toLowerCase()
if (
(lowerKey.includes("apikey") ||
lowerKey.includes("api_key") ||
lowerKey === "password" ||
lowerKey === "secret" ||
lowerKey === "token" ||
lowerKey === "authorization" ||
lowerKey === "credential" ||
lowerKey === "private_key" ||
lowerKey === "privatekey") &&
typeof value === "string" &&
value.length > 0
) {
result[key] = "[REDACTED]"
} else {
result[key] = redactDiagnosticsData(value)
}
}
return result
}
// Numbers, booleans, etc. pass through unchanged
return data
}
